Late-onset myasthenia gravis – CTLA4low genotype association and low-for-age thymic output of naïve T cells

Chuang, Wen-Yu ; Ströbel, Philipp ; Bohlender-Willke, Anna-Lena ; Rieckmann, Peter ; Nix, Wilfred ; Schalke, Berthold ; Gold, Ralf ; Opitz, Andreas ; Klinker, Erdwine ; Inoue, Masayoshi ; Müller-Hermelink, Hans Konrad ; Saruhan-Direskeneli, Güher ; Bugert, Peter ; Willcox, Nick ; Marx, Alexander



Abstract

Late-onset myasthenia gravis (LOMG) has become the largest MG subgroup, but the underlying pathogenetic mechanisms remain mysterious. Among the few etiological clues are the almost unique serologic parallels between LOMG and thymoma-associated MG (TAMG), notably autoantibodies against acetylcholine receptors, titin, ryanodine receptor, type I interferons or IL-12.
